Hi there this is Josefin and little puppy Chiko av Serjas.

We live in Sweden and Chiko is my first puppy / my first own dog. I have had dogs before, but not by myself and I had a puppy last year on a breeding contract, "on breeders terms" but I wasn't ready for a puppy so I had to return her.

Now I bought my own puppy instead and having lots of fun but also lots of naughty behaviour and mischief from this stubborn little guy.

Hi Josefin (and Chiko)! Smile

Hang in there, schnauzers seem to have a wicked naughty streak in the "teenage" phase, but it passes. And once you get through that spot he'll understand what the rules are and he'll be really sweet. They do want to please by nature. We found that a long walk when Merlin started to get a little naughty really helped. It seemed if he had structured exercise he had an easier time behaving himself.

Enjoy your new furbaby!
